Sourcing guidance for Potentiometer Knob
What are the key technical specifications to consider when selecting a Potentiometer Knob?
When sourcing potentiometer knobs, the most critical factor is the shaft hole diameter and type. Common sizes include 6mm and 6.35mm (1/4 inch). You must specify whether you need a D-shape (flatted) hole, a star/splined hole (usually 18-tooth), or a round hole with a set screw. Additionally, consider the outer diameter and height to ensure the knob fits the physical constraints of your device's control panel.
Which materials are best suited for different industrial applications?
Material choice impacts both durability and user experience. Aluminum alloy knobs are preferred for high-end audio and medical equipment due to their premium feel and EMI shielding properties. Bakelite (phenolic resin) is ideal for high-temperature environments or vintage-style electronics because of its excellent insulation and heat resistance. For cost-sensitive consumer electronics, ABS plastic with a soft-touch rubber coating provides a balance of economy and grip comfort.
What compliance standards should a Potentiometer Knob meet for international trade?
For global market entry, ensure the products are RoHS (Restriction of Hazardous Substances) compliant, especially regarding lead and cadmium content in metal inserts. For the European market, REACH certification is necessary. If the knobs are used in medical or food-grade equipment, verify that the materials meet FDA or ISO 10993 standards to ensure they do not leach harmful chemicals during skin contact.
How can I verify the quality of the indicator markings on the knob?
The longevity of the indicator line is vital for usability. Engraved or recessed lines filled with enamel paint are far more durable than simple silk-screened markings, which may rub off over time. For high-precision equipment, look for CNC-machined indicators or double-shot injection molding where the indicator is a separate piece of plastic molded into the body, ensuring it never fades.
Cross-Border Procurement & Risk Management for Potentiometer Knobs
How can I mitigate the risk of 'fitment failure' when buying from overseas suppliers?
The most common risk is a mismatch between the knob and the potentiometer shaft. To mitigate this, request a technical drawing (PDF/CAD) from the supplier before ordering and compare it with your component specs. Always order a physical sample (usually 5-10 pieces) to test the 'torque feel' and fit tightness. What are the best strategies for negotiating pricing for bulk electronic components?
Since potentiometer knobs are low-value, high-volume items, shipping often represents a large portion of the cost. Negotiate based on Total Landed Cost. Ask for tiered pricing (e.g., 1k, 5k, and 10k units). If you are a repeat buyer, negotiate for custom packaging (blister packs or anti-static bags) to be included in the unit price, which saves you labor costs during your own assembly process.
